Progressive Car Insurance - Coverage For Cars Stolen With Keys in It

If your car was stolen, it is important to submit a police report right away. You will be asked to provide your VIN, as well as the time and location of the theft, as well as any personal items you have inside the vehicle. You should also contact nearby businesses to find out whether they have surveillance cameras.

Comprehensive coverage

If you have comprehensive auto insurance, your vehicle should be covered if it is stolen, so that the theft was not at fault. Comprehensive insurance can cover a variety of things, including theft, vandalism and other damages to your vehicle that might not be caused by an accident. If you're covered for this, you are able to claim the cost of replacing or repair your vehicle that was stolen. However, the policy doesn't cover personal belongings that were in the car when it was taken. You will need to make a separate claim through your homeowner's or renters' insurance company.

After you have completed the police report, contact Progressive to file claims on your vehicle theft insurance. An agent will assist you through the process and ensure that you have all the information necessary to receive reimbursement. They might ask for documents, like police reports or talk to an adjuster in order to determine the value of your vehicle. It is essential to cooperate with the claim agent and provide any requested information as soon as you can.

If your car is not recovered, Progressive will cut you a check for the actual cash value (ACV) which is determined by the value of comparable vehicles on the market and factors like depreciation. It may not be the exact amount you paid for your car and you may have to pay a small amount of deductible. It's recommended to add gap insurance and new replacement cost coverage for your vehicle to your policy.

Progressive offers additional coverages that include gap insurance and rideshare. Gap insurance helps cover the difference between a loan amount and the actual cash value of your car when it is stolen or damaged and reduces your financial risk. Rideshare coverage can be added to your auto insurance policy to cover your vehicle while you are connected to a ridesharing app or waiting for a customer.
